I am mostly interested in downloadable clip sales but I also sell through VOD/PPV sites too. I already do business with most of the VOD services that stream my full length DVD movies like AdultRental, Hotmovies, AEBN etc who all pay on the order of 20%. It may work out to much as 40%-50% if you send the traffic to your own white label and own the studio for the movie minutes watched.

Then you have Clips.com for downloadable clip sales who pays 40% I believe, as well as Clips4Sale who pays 60%- currently the best deal for a studio. Between all that it is okay extra money, especially since it's their traffic driving most of the sales.

But really I want to license a solution to earn 100% of my downloadable clip revenue on sales generated from my own traffic (without spending mega bucks to get it) or, alternatively a downloadable clip service that works like Clips4Sale does but where the split is much higher than 60% for the studio.
